Iikka Kangasniemi, 30, who was one of the key players for Pelicans last season, is changing teams in the Liiga.
According to MTV Sports, the skillful scorer has signed a one-year contract with Kiekko-Espoo. Last season, Kangasniemi scored 9+26=35 points in 54 regular-season games while wearing the Pelicans jersey.
Kangasniemi has represented Blues and HIFK in addition to Pelicans in the Liiga. The 170-centimeter forward has played a total of 420 regular-season games with a total of 105+177=282 points.
